Our read on Parkside School

Specialist School With Strong Foundations, Growing Thoughtfully

Parkside School is a specialist school in Pukekohe serving students aged 5–21 with high and very high special educational needs. ERO's report highlights strong relationships, capable leadership, and effective student support as key strengths. The school is actively working to improve communication systems as it manages the challenges of significant roll growth across a geographically spread network of campuses.

What is Parkside School's Equity Index?
The listed EQI is 493. EQI reflects socioeconomic barriers used for funding; it is not a school-quality score.

About OSCAR Programmes

Many New Zealand schools have OSCAR-approved before and after school programmes. These programmes provide supervised care, activities, and often homework help during extended hours.

  • Typical hours: 7am-8:30am and 3pm-6pm
  • Childcare subsidy may be available through WINZ
  • Some are run on-site, others at nearby community centres
